Class Splitter
Namespace: Aspose.Words.LowCode
Assembly: Aspose.Words.dll
Poskytuje metody určené k rozdělení dokumentů na části podle různých kritérií.
public static class SplitterDědičnost
Děděné členy
object.GetType(), object.MemberwiseClone(), object.ToString(), object.Equals(object?), object.Equals(object?, object?), object.ReferenceEquals(object?, object?), object.GetHashCode()
Metody
ExtractPages(string, string, int, int)
Extrahuje určený rozsah stránek z dokumentu a uloží extrahované stránky do nového souboru. Formát výstupního souboru je určen příponou názvu výstupního souboru.
public static void ExtractPages(string inputFileName, string outputFileName, int startPageIndex, int pageCount)Parametry
inputFileName string
Název vstupního souboru.
outputFileName string
Název výstupního souboru.
startPageIndex int
Index první stránky k extrakci (index začíná od nuly).
pageCount int
Počet stránek k extrakci.
ExtractPages(string, string, SaveFormat, int, int)
Extrahuje určený rozsah stránek z dokumentu a uloží extrahované stránky do nového souboru pomocí určeného formátu uložení.
public static void ExtractPages(string inputFileName, string outputFileName, SaveFormat saveFormat, int startPageIndex, int pageCount)Parametry
inputFileName string
Název vstupního souboru.
outputFileName string
Název výstupního souboru.
saveFormat SaveFormat
Formát uložení.
startPageIndex int
Index první stránky k extrakci (index začíná od nuly).
pageCount int
Počet stránek k extrakci.
ExtractPages(Stream, Stream, SaveFormat, int, int)
Extrahuje určený rozsah stránek z dokumentového proudu a uloží extrahované stránky do výstupního proudu pomocí určeného formátu uložení.
public static void ExtractPages(Stream inputStream, Stream outputStream, SaveFormat saveFormat, int startPageIndex, int pageCount)Parametry
inputStream Stream
Vstupní proud.
outputStream Stream
Výstupní proud.
saveFormat SaveFormat
Formát uložení.
startPageIndex int
Index první stránky k extrakci (index začíná od nuly).
pageCount int
Počet stránek k extrakci.
RemoveBlankPages(string, string)
Odstraní prázdné stránky z dokumentu a uloží výstup. Vrací seznam čísel stránek, které byly odstraněny.
public static List<int> RemoveBlankPages(string inputFileName, string outputFileName)Parametry
inputFileName string
Název vstupního souboru.
outputFileName string
Název výstupního souboru.
Vrací
Seznam čísel stránek, které byly považovány za prázdné a odstraněny.
RemoveBlankPages(string, string, SaveFormat)
Odstraní prázdné stránky z dokumentu a uloží výstup ve specifikovaném formátu. Vrací seznam čísel stránek, které byly odstraněny.
public static List<int> RemoveBlankPages(string inputFileName, string outputFileName, SaveFormat saveFormat)Parametry
inputFileName string
Název vstupního souboru.
outputFileName string
Název výstupního souboru.
saveFormat SaveFormat
Formát uložení.
Vrací
Seznam čísel stránek, které byly považovány za prázdné a odstraněny.
RemoveBlankPages(Stream, Stream, SaveFormat)
Odstraní prázdné stránky z dokumentu poskytnutého ve vstupním proudu a uloží aktualizovaný dokument do výstupního proudu ve specifikovaném formátu uložení. Vrací seznam čísel stránek, které byly odstraněny.
public static List<int> RemoveBlankPages(Stream inputStream, Stream outputStream, SaveFormat saveFormat)Parametry
inputStream Stream
Vstupní proud.
outputStream Stream
Výstupní proud.
saveFormat SaveFormat
Formát uložení.
Vrací
Seznam čísel stránek, které byly považovány za prázdné a odstraněny.
Split(string, string, SplitOptions)
Rozdělí dokument na více částí na základě určených možností rozdělení a uloží výsledné části do souborů. Formát výstupního souboru je určen příponou názvu výstupního souboru.
public static void Split(string inputFileName, string outputFileName, SplitOptions options)Parametry
inputFileName string
Název vstupního souboru.
outputFileName string
Název výstupního souboru používaný k vygenerování názvu souboru pro části dokumentu pomocí pravidla “outputFile_partIndex.extension”
options SplitOptions
Možnosti rozdělení dokumentu.
Split(string, string, SaveFormat, SplitOptions)
Rozdělí dokument na více částí na základě určených možností rozdělení a uloží výsledné části do souborů ve specifikovaném formátu uložení.
public static void Split(string inputFileName, string outputFileName, SaveFormat saveFormat, SplitOptions options)Parametry
inputFileName string
Název vstupního souboru.
outputFileName string
Název výstupního souboru používaný k vygenerování názvu souboru pro části dokumentu pomocí pravidla “outputFile_partIndex.extension”
saveFormat SaveFormat
Formát uložení.
options SplitOptions
Možnosti rozdělení dokumentu.
Split(Stream, SaveFormat, SplitOptions)
Rozdělí dokument z vstupního proudu na více částí na základě určených možností rozdělení a vrátí výsledné části jako pole proudů ve specifikovaném formátu uložení.
public static Stream[] Split(Stream inputStream, SaveFormat saveFormat, SplitOptions options)Parametry
inputStream Stream
Vstupní proud.
saveFormat SaveFormat
Formát uložení.
options SplitOptions
Možnosti rozdělení dokumentu.
Vrací
Stream[]